To be eligible to vote in any Scarsdale Union Free School District (SUFSD) election, budget vote, or referendum, residents of the District must be:
- At least 18 years of age
- A citizen of the United States
- A resident of the SUFSD for at least 30 days before the vote date
- Registered to vote

Residents must be registered for either general elections (with the Westchester County Board of Elections) or school elections. Any person who resides in the SUFSD and is registered with the Westchester County Board of Elections to vote in our District does not need to register separately with the District, OR you must be registered with SUFSD and have voted in a school election within the past four years.
If you are not registered to vote, you may:
- Register with the Westchester County Board of Elections using the New York State Voter Registration Form.
- File an online application with the New York State Department of Motor Vehicles.
- Register with SUFSD using the Registration Form (Spanish) with the District Clerk by appointment. *Registration forms need to be signed at the time of registration. Voter registration forms for the May 19th Budget Vote and Board Elections will be accepted until 5:00 p.m. on Thursday, May 14, 2026.

The Board of Education is the policy-making body of the Scarsdale Union Free School District, responsible for the general supervision of the schools. The seven elected, volunteer members of the Board serve staggered terms of three years. Custom calls for a limit of two terms.
